Solution 34P
Here in each equation, we have to label the acids, bases, and conjugate pairs:
According to the Bronsted-Lowry concept, an acid will always form its conjugate base (CB) by donating a proton and a conjugate acid (CA) is always formed by a base by gaining a proton.
In general, the dissociation of an acid in aqueous medium is given below,
HA + H2O ⇄ H3O+ + A-
Acid base CA CB
